溫馨提示×

如何限制Linux FTP服務器帶寬使用

小樊
33
2025-10-21 09:38:21
欄目: 云計算

要限制Linux FTP服務器的帶寬使用,可以使用以下方法:

  1. 使用trickle工具:

trickle是一個輕量級的帶寬管理工具,可以限制程序的網絡帶寬使用。首先,確保已經安裝了trickle。在Debian/Ubuntu系統上,可以使用以下命令安裝:

sudo apt-get install trickle

在CentOS/RHEL系統上,可以使用以下命令安裝:

sudo yum install trickle

接下來,使用trickle限制FTP服務器的帶寬。例如,如果要限制vsftpd的上傳速度為100KB/s,下載速度為100KB/s,可以使用以下命令:

trickle -u 100 -d 100 vsftpd
  1. 使用wondershaper工具:

wondershaper是一個用于限制網絡接口帶寬的工具。首先,確保已經安裝了wondershaper。在Debian/Ubuntu系統上,可以使用以下命令安裝:

sudo apt-get install wondershaper

在CentOS/RHEL系統上,可以使用以下命令安裝:

sudo yum install wondershaper

接下來,使用wondershaper限制FTP服務器的帶寬。例如,如果要限制eth0接口的上傳速度為100KB/s,下載速度為100KB/s,可以使用以下命令:

sudo wondershaper eth0 100 100

注意:在使用wondershaper時,需要先停止FTP服務器,然后在限制帶寬后重新啟動FTP服務器。

  1. 使用FTP服務器配置:

某些FTP服務器軟件允許您直接在配置文件中限制帶寬。例如,在vsftpd中,可以在vsftpd.conf文件中添加以下行來限制每個用戶的帶寬:

local_max_rate=100000

這將限制每個用戶的帶寬為100KB/s。然后,重啟vsftpd服務以使更改生效:

sudo systemctl restart vsftpd

請注意,這些方法可能不適用于所有FTP服務器軟件。請查閱您所使用的FTP服務器軟件的文檔以獲取更多關于限制帶寬的信息。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女